My Constant

Violent death
Summer leaves fearing the Autumn winds
Steal from me a moment
a whisper
a smile
a kiss

Before the chill of death demands
That I admit the lie

Snowflakes dancing on fallen leaves
Wooden bough's weeping
Sad and tired
the liar grieves

I desire faith
I am afraid I will betray
Beautiful eyes
You are my demise
Because even though we told the truth when we said
"till death do us part"
My heart screamed "NO!"

Wicked whisper in my ear
Your voice
tickling the air in my lungs

You know
You see the lies in my eyes
You are...

melting ice cream on the tongue
dizziness on a merry-go-round
naps on the sofa in the late afternoon
movies in the theaters, your lips tasting like popcorn
waking to the smell of your husband cooking you breakfast
huddling under the covers with a flashlight and a bible
holding each other when we cry
holding our children in our arms
letting our children go
growing old and crazy together

death

death cannot have you
I don't like to share
My God has conquered your greedy hands
